文章目录

  • 简介:
  • 1.首先进入comsol
  • 2.建立几何模型
  • 3.设置物理场
  • 4.设置材料属性
  • 5.设置密度法拓扑优化的必要参数
  • 6.划分网格设置求解器
  • 7.计算结果展示

简介:

最近在B站上看到了一个共轭传热的拓扑优化案例,感觉很有意思,但是up并没有直接公开他的案例,这里复现一下。
算例文件(.mph)已上传至https://download.csdn.net/download/qq_42183549/75996650

1.首先进入comsol

选择二维模型,共轭传热、层流、优化模块。

2.建立几何模型

这里设置流场为1*0.1,圆形区域的半径分别为0.04与0.02。

3.设置物理场

流体入口的压力设置为100pa
出口压力设置为0pa

4.设置材料属性

使用内置材料水与铝

内部小圆为铝(热源)
当然需要对设计域的材料物性进行插值,这里只对导热系数进行简单的插值。

5.设置密度法拓扑优化的必要参数

选择大圆为拓扑优化设计域,使用双曲正切投影。

设置优化全局目标为固体热源平均温度。

6.划分网格设置求解器

网格根据需要进行划分,这里保持默认值。
优化求解器使用GCMMA算法

7.计算结果展示

在计算500步之后我们就可以得到拓扑优化结果。红色部分就是流体域。

共轭传热拓扑优化算例分享相关推荐

  1. 单代号网络图计算例题_算例分享:SDOF动力系统的共振响应计算

    本文给出一个单自由度系统的共振响应分析实例. 单自由度体系受到简谐荷载激励,相关参数如下: 单自由度体系刚度k=2×106N/m,质量m=2×105kg,阻尼c=1.0×105N·s/m,受到0.5H ...

  2. 微电网日前优化调度 。算例有代码(1)

    个人电气博文传送门 学好电气全靠它,个人电气博文目录(持续更新中-) 符号说明 问题1 求解 经济性评估方案: 若微网中蓄电池不作用,且微网与电网交换功率无约束,在无可再生能源和 可再生能源全额利用两 ...

  3. FLUENT算例2:混合弯管的流动与传热

    文章目录 FLUENT算例2:混合弯管的流动与传热 1. 问题描述 2. 网格划分 3. 计算设置 3.1 GENERAL 3.2 MODEL 3.3 MATERIALS 3.4 Cell Zone ...

  4. comsol with matlab 传热结构的拓扑优化

    想利用comsol with matlab 做一下传热结构的拓扑优化,已经在comsol中建好了几何模型以及物理场,请问接下来该如何在matlab中操作呀.

  5. 自由移动的气泡_STARCCM+标准算例展示之——曳力作用下的气泡上升速度

    1. 案例目标 验证气液多相系统水中不同大小气泡采用如下不同曳力模型时的自由沉降最终速度: • 中度污染水系统Tomiyama drag coefficient • 纯水系统Tomiyama drag ...

  6. chtMultiRegionFoam求解器及算例分析

    1. 算例分析 1.1. 算例结构 算例目录heatTransfer/chtMultiRegionFoam/heatedDuct 0 fluid p p_rgh T U heater T metal ...

  7. Fluent算例1:交叉管内流动

    文章目录 Fluent算例1:交叉管内流动 1. 问题描述及分析 1.1 问题描述 1.2 问题分析 2. 几何模型 2.1 建立几何模型 2.2 修改边界区域 3. 网格划分 3.1 模式选择 3. ...

  8. matlab对拓扑的处理,Matlab的图形处理器并行计算及其在拓扑优化中的应用

    Journal of Computer Applications 计算机应用,2016,36(3):628-632,652 ISSN 1oo1.9081 C0DEN JYIIDU 2016-03一l0 ...

  9. 车间调度丨粒子群算法初探:以算例MK01为例

    车间调度系列文章: 1.车间调度的编码.解码,调度方案可视化的探讨 2.多目标优化:浅谈pareto寻优和非支配排序遗传算法-NSGAII的非支配排序及拥挤度 3.柔性车间调度问题:以算例MK01初探 ...

最新文章

  1. 你的设备中缺少重要的安全和质量修复_城市排水管道三类非开挖修复技术汇总...
  2. SAP 物料主数据屏幕增强
  3. nyoj-Human Gene Functions
  4. linux怎么开机默认进入桌面图标,如何让ubuntu开机默认进入命令行啊?
  5. mysql运算结果放入表中_MySQL表1新增数据,计算开始、结束日期之间所有时间,插入到表2中...
  6. python 幂运算 整数_在Python中检查一个数字是否是另一个数字的幂
  7. Linux Intel网卡IGB驱动修改mac地址
  8. SAP WDA 自建Portal
  9. java jettison_java – 使用Jettison进行JSON解析
  10. 关于eclipse反编译插件不起作用问题的解决
  11. linux自动清除超出的文件,Linux下面自动清理超过指定大小的文件
  12. IE的Kiosk模式
  13. python 四维数据怎么看性别_四维b超数据怎么看性别
  14. 使用MQTTNet包实现客户端与服务端通讯
  15. Springcloud入门第二篇
  16. 怎么在线压缩PDF文件?常见途径说明
  17. 入门Web前端开发需要学习哪些技术?薪资高吗?
  18. DPlayer视频播放器使用方法介绍
  19. 高佣次方递增营销联盟模式
  20. M1芯片已适配达芬奇DaVinci Resolve苹果M1处理器安装新版达芬奇17教程(适配最新M1芯片处理器款mac,支持Big sur )

热门文章

  1. 一个简单51c语言程序,三个简单的C语言程序(上)
  2. promis取值问题 --- 通过.then
  3. Adobe Flash Builder 4 注册码
  4. ABAQUS 2018 cae闪退 解决方案, 亲测可行
  5. 电脑重装系统(U盘)
  6. mybatis 无效的列类型: 1111
  7. 小白浏览器无障碍AI字幕的提取方法 超级简单
  8. iPhone的全球之旅 读书笔记
  9. 计算机网络实验——FTP服务器配置(使用windows IIS服务)
  10. 【华为OD机试真题JAVA】绘图机器的绘图问题